The Hillview buying strategy.
If we were buying in Hillview today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.
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.
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.
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.
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

A community defined by the homes, not the amenity sheet
When a community has no clubhouse, pool, or trail system listed against it, the practical effect is that every purchase decision in Hillview comes down to the individual property. Buyers should expect variation in age, layout, and condition from one listing to the next, since there is no shared standard being set by an association amenity build-out.
That also means comparable-sales work matters more than usual. Without a common amenity or lifestyle feature to anchor pricing across the community, each home in Hillview needs to be evaluated on its own merits — lot size, interior condition, recent updates — rather than assumed to track a community-wide premium.
